Off

This word has many meanings including the following:

Off: not on, no longer on

  • Her glasses fell off.
  • He fell off the ladder.

Off: away

  • They ran off when the police arrived.

Off: not working or operating

  • The heating is off.
  • Switch off the lights.

Off: away or down from

  • Keep off the grass!
  • The cat jumped off the table.

Off: near to but not on; leading from

  • A house just off the main road
  • A road off the high street
  • An island off the coast
